Basis ADB- en Fastboot-opdrachten die u moet leren om Android Pro te worden
Android Tips En Trucs / / August 05, 2021
Bijgewerkt op 1 maart 2020: We hebben meer adb-opdrachten toegevoegd om deze tutorial nog beter te maken. U kunt een bladwijzer voor deze pagina maken voor toekomstig gebruik om uw Android-apparaat aan te passen.
De meesten van ons kunnen via vingers met ons apparaat praten - aanraakscherm als ik mag. Er zijn echter bepaalde gevallen waarin het touchscreen niet werkt of het hele apparaat niet werkt. In dat geval moet u op zijn minst de basis ADB-opdrachten kennen om uw zaken voor elkaar te krijgen. Deze omvatten het wakker maken van uw apparaat, snel opnieuw opstarten, fabrieksinstellingen herstellen, enz. Er is sowieso niets mis met het leren van nieuwe vaardigheden, toch? Dus zonder verder te doen, laten we beginnen met enkele basis ADB-opdrachten voor Android-smartphones.
Voordat we beginnen, willen we verklaren dat dit geen volledige gedetailleerde discussie over ABD-opdrachten zal zijn. Dit zijn alle belangrijke die u moet weten voor het geval u de controle over uw apparaat verliest. Dat houdt ook in dat u zich in een bevroren staat bevindt, of dat uw gegevens beschadigd zijn, u geen toegang heeft tot uw apparaat en zo. Deze ADB-commando's helpen je om je apparaat weer tot leven te wekken in een dode toestand of helpen je om hier en daar dingen te kopiëren. Dit zijn eenvoudig te gebruiken tools die u in de toekomst van pas zullen komen.
Inhoudsopgave
- 1 Basis ADB-opdracht die u moet leren om Android Pro te worden
-
2 Hoe ADB en Fastboot Tool te installeren en in te stellen?
- 2.1 1. De ADB-apparatenopdracht
- 2.2 2. Het adb push-commando
- 2.3 3. Het adb pull-commando
- 2.4 adb pull
[lokaal] - 2.5 4. De adb reboot-opdracht
- 2.6 5. De adb reboot-bootloader en adb herstart herstelopdrachten
- 2.7 6. Het fastboot devices commando
- 2.8 7. De fastboot-ontgrendelingsopdracht
- 2.9 8. Het adb-shell-commando
- 2.10 9. Het adb install commando
- 2.11 10. De adb sideload-opdracht
Basis ADB-opdracht die u moet leren om Android Pro te worden
Elke Android-ontwikkelaar of Android-liefhebber zou enkele basis ADB-opdrachten moeten kennen. Want waarom niet? U kunt veel meer bereiken met deze basis ADB-opdrachten. Het gebruik van standaard ADB-opdrachten is net als het gebruik van sneltoetsen. Ze maken de zaken gemakkelijker te bedienen. Dus laten we beginnen met een paar Basic ADB-opdrachten.
Hoe ADB en Fastboot Tool te installeren en in te stellen?
We hebben een gedetailleerde handleiding voor installatie ADB en Fastboot-tool op Windows en we hebben ook een aparte handleiding over hoe we kunnen installeren ADB Fastboot op Mac of Linux.
Het instellen van ADB en Fastboot is heel eenvoudig. Aangezien ADB en Fastboot beide deel uitmaken van het Android SDK-pakket, hoeft u alleen de kit te downloaden (die meer dan 500 MB groot is) en stel vervolgens padvariabelen in, of de hieronder beschreven methoden kunnen worden gebruikt om ADB en fastboot-stuurprogramma op Windows en macOS. Maar eerst moet u onthouden dat u uw apparaat moet plaatsen USB-foutopsporingsmodus, maar daarvoor moet u schakel de ontwikkelaaroptie in. Als u deze stap gewoon negeert, is het mogelijk dat uw pc uw apparaat niet herkent.
Notitie:
Voordat u begint, moet u ervoor zorgen dat u deze opdrachten niet probeert totdat en tenzij ze absoluut noodzakelijk zijn.
Waarschuwing!
Wij redacteuren bij GetdroidTips zijn niet verantwoordelijk voor enige schade die wordt veroorzaakt door het gebruik van deze basis ADB-opdrachten.
1. De ADB-apparatenopdracht
De "adb devices" is een zeer populaire ADB-opdracht die we gebruiken om alle apparaten in de opdrachtprompt weer te geven die klaar zijn om opdrachten op te nemen voor actie. Niettemin om te zeggen dat het een van de belangrijkste commando's is, want zonder adb-apparaten kunt u helemaal niet op uw smartphone werken.
adb-apparaten
Notitie
U moet ervoor zorgen dat de Android USB-foutopsporingsmodus is ingeschakeld op uw Android-apparaat. De opdracht "adb devices" werkt niet als USB-foutopsporing is uitgeschakeld.
Als u een Android-professional bent, moet u deze opdracht kennen, omdat deze u zal vertellen of uw pc en Android-apparaat zijn verbonden via de Android Debug Bridge of niet.
2. Het adb push-commando
Deze opdracht is handig wanneer u bestanden programmatisch naar uw Android-apparaat moet verplaatsen. Om dit te laten werken, moet u enkele parameters kennen, zoals de naam van het bestand en het volledige pad van het bestand. Daarna kunt u bestanden naar uw apparaat pushen.
Upload een gespecificeerd bestand van uw computer naar een emulator / apparaat.
adb push
adb push test.apk / sdcard
Kopieën
adb push d: \ test.apk / sdcard
In het bovenstaande voorbeeld ziet u hoe u een songbestand naar de muziekmap op uw smartphone kunt pushen.
3. Het adb pull-commando
Deze opdracht wordt gebruikt om dingen uit uw apparaat te halen. In dit scenario kunt u bestanden en mappen van uw apparaat naar uw computer halen. Het enige dat u hoeft te weten, is de bestands- of mapnaam om bestanden te verplaatsen. Deze push- en pull-opdrachten zijn uitermate handig als u een back-up van uw apparaat wilt maken.
Download een gespecificeerd bestand van een emulator / apparaat naar uw computer.
adb pull [lokaal]
adb pull /sdcard/demo.mp4
download /sdcard/demo.mp4 naar
adb pull /sdcard/demo.mp4 e: \
download /sdcard/demo.mp4 om E.
4. De adb reboot-opdracht
adb herstart
Dit is een buitengewoon handig commando voor aangepaste ROM-makers en Android-ontwikkelaars in het algemeen. Er zijn momenten dat ontwikkelaars de Android-apparaten opnieuw moeten opstarten. Het is dus gemakkelijker om de opdracht te typen in plaats van fysiek op de knop te drukken. Dit kan ook worden geautomatiseerd met behulp van een script tijdens het installeren van een aangepaste kernel of een aangepast ROM. Kortom, het is een zeer nuttige opdracht, zelfs voor dagelijkse Android-gebruikers.
5. De adb reboot-bootloader en adb herstart herstelopdrachten
De vorige opdracht die we zojuist hebben besproken, kan worden gebruikt om een apparaat opnieuw op te starten. Er zijn echter nog andere basis-ADB-opdrachten die u kunt gebruiken om uw apparaat in een bepaalde modus opnieuw op te starten.
adb herstart herstel
Met het “adb reboot recovery” -commando kunt u uw apparaat opnieuw opstarten in de bootloader-modus. Het is eenvoudig, typ gewoon adb reboot-bootloader en druk op de enter-toets.
adb herstart bootloader
Met deze opdracht start je je apparaat op in de bootloader, waar je je bootloader kunt ontgrendelen, opnieuw kunt opstarten in de fastboot- en herstelmodus en een aantal andere taken kunt uitvoeren.
Lees ook: Hoe TWRP op Huawei Watch te installeren
6. Het fastboot devices commando
Als u zich in de bootloader-modus bevindt, werkt geen van uw zogenaamde ADB-opdrachten. Dit komt doordat de Android niet is opgestart en de USB-foutopsporingsbrug niet is geactiveerd om mee te communiceren. Dus in dergelijke scenario's gebruiken we de opdracht "fastboot" om met het apparaat te communiceren.
Fastboot is een van de beste en levensreddende adb-opdrachten die beschikbaar zijn voor Android-gebruikers. U kunt bestanden doorgeven, communiceren, deal-smartphones nieuw leven inblazen en nog veel meer. Maar zorg ervoor dat u over voldoende fastboot-stuurprogramma's voor uw Android-apparaat beschikt, want adb-stuurprogramma's werken hier niet.
adb herstart fastboot
U kunt de bovenstaande opdracht gebruiken om uw apparaat rechtstreeks in de fastboot-modus op te starten.
fastboot-apparaat
Met deze opdracht wordt gecontroleerd of het apparaat is aangesloten op de pc.
Lees ook: Hoe Moto Z2 Force Unlocked Bootloader-waarschuwingsbericht te verwijderen
7. De fastboot-ontgrendelingsopdracht
Als je de bootloader voor je Android-apparaat wilt ontgrendelen, helpt deze opdracht je er doorheen te komen. Het ontgrendelen van de bootloader wordt echter niet op elk apparaat ondersteund, maar als dat wel het geval is. Je kunt het doen via het fastboot-commando. Dit is het mooie van het open Android-systeem, aangezien het Google en smartphonefabrikanten niet kan schelen wat de gebruikers met hun apparaat doen. Ze staan open voor allerlei experimenten.
Hier is een paar opdracht voor het ontgrendelen van de bootloader:
fastboot knipperend ontgrendelen
fastboot oem ontgrendelen
Om te controleren of de bootloader van uw apparaat is ontgrendeld of niet
fastboot oem apparaat-info
8. Het adb-shell-commando
Dit is een van de meest verwarrende, maar het is een zeer nuttige opdrachtmensen. U kunt dit gebruiken om opdrachten naar uw apparaat te sturen om zijn eigen scripts en opdrachten uit te voeren. Hoe cool is dat? U kunt ook echt zien wat de opdrachtshell van uw apparaat op uw scherm doet.
In deze afbeelding hierboven kunt u de binnenkant van de apparaatshell zien. Typ gewoon "adb shell" en voer in. U komt in de shell-modus van het apparaat.
Notitie
Dit is geen op DOS gebaseerde opdrachtshell. Het is hetzelfde als wat mensen gebruiken op Linux- of Mac-computers, dus gebruik het verstandig.
9. Het adb install commando
We hebben het al gehad over adb push- en pull-opdrachten. Maar wist u dat u daadwerkelijk apps op uw apparaat kunt installeren met een simpele opdracht? Wauw, klinkt geweldig, toch? U hebt alleen het pad nodig waar u het .apk-bestand van de app opslaat. Daarna moet u de opdracht als volgt invoeren:
adb installeer TheAppName.apk
Als u van plan bent een bestaande app bij te werken, moet u deze zo schrijven
adb install -r TheAppName.apk
10. De adb sideload-opdracht
Wilt u uw apparaat bijwerken met een niet-officiële OTS-update (over the air)? We hebben fam! U kunt de officiële / officiële OTA-update downloaden en ongedaan maken en deze installeren via de adb sideload-opdracht. Het enige wat u hoeft te doen is opstarten in het herstelproces en de toetsen omhoog / omlaag gebruiken om naar "Update van ADB toepassen" te navigeren. Typ daarna deze opdracht en je bent klaar om te gaan:
adb sideload Full-Path-to-the-file.zip
Opdracht | Functies |
ADB-opdrachten | |
adb-apparaten | Toont aangesloten apparaten |
adb-shell | Om van de Windows-opdrachtprompt naar de Android-apparaatshell te gaan: |
adb herstart bootloader | Om op te starten in de bootloader-modus |
adb herstart herstel | Om op te starten in herstel |
adb get-serienr | Krijg het serienummer van uw verbonden apparaat |
adb installeren | Om apps te installeren via adb |
adb install -r | Om de bestaande apps bij te werken met een nieuwe versie |
adb verwijder pakketnaam.hier | Om apps of pakketten van het verbonden apparaat te verwijderen |
adb uninstall -package_name.here | Bewaar de gegevens- en cachemappen na het verwijderen van apps |
adb push | Upload een gespecificeerd bestand van uw computer naar het apparaat |
adb pull | Download een gespecificeerd bestand van uw apparaat naar uw computer. |
adb-back-up | Maak een back-up van uw apparaat naar pc |
adb herstellen | Zet de back-up terug op uw telefoon |
adb sideload | Om apps of flashable zip-bestand op uw apparaat te sideloaden |
adb logcat | Haal het realtime logboek van uw telefoon |
adb start-server | start adb-serversprocessen |
adb kill-server | stop adb-serverprocessen |
adb herstart fastboot | Start uw apparaat opnieuw op in de fastboot-modus |
adb usb | toont alle apparaten die via een USB-kabel op uw computer zijn aangesloten. |
adb devices // toon aangesloten apparaten | Het toont de lijst met alle apparaten die op uw pc zijn aangesloten. |
adb connect ip_address_of_device | verbind het IP-adres van uw Android-apparaat met uw computer. |
Fastboot-opdrachten | |
fastboot-apparaten | Toont aangesloten apparaten op uw pc / laptop |
fastboot herstart | Om uw apparaat opnieuw op te starten |
fastboot herstart herstel | Om uw apparaat op te starten in de herstelmodus |
fastboot oem apparaat-info | Om de ontgrendelingsstatus van de bootloader te controleren: |
fastboot oem ontgrendelen | Als het bovenstaande commando fall terugkeert, voer dan het volgende uit om de bootloader te ontgrendelen |
fastboot knipperend ontgrendelen | Er zijn maar weinig OEM's die deze opdracht gebruiken om de bootloader te ontgrendelen |
fastboot knippert unlock_critical | Sta ook het flashen van bootloader-gerelateerde partities toe: |
fastboot oem apparaat-info | controleer de vergrendelings- / ontgrendelingsstatus van de bootloader |
fastboot flash-herstel [recovery.img] | Om herstel op uw apparaat te flashen |
fastboot boot [boot.img] | Om het herstel te testen zonder permanent te knipperen |
fastboot-indeling: ext4 userdata | Om de gegevenspartitie te formatteren |
fastboot flash boot [naam boot img] | flash flashable boot.img vanuit fastboot-modus |
fastboot getvar cid | Om de CID van uw apparaat weer te geven |
Knipperend ROM via Fastboot ROM zip-pakket | |
fastboot -w |
Om uw apparaat te wissen en vervolgens naar flash.zip |
Nou, jongens, dit zijn alle basis ADB-opdrachten die je moet weten als je een Android-fan bent. Ik weet zeker dat je vandaag veel nieuwe dingen hebt geleerd. Laat ons weten welk commando je het leukst vond in de commentaarsectie hieronder.
Gerelateerde berichten:
- Download ADB, Fastboot - Android SDK Platform Tools
- uBlock Origin vs Adblock Plus: welke Adblocker je moet kiezen 2018
- Download Android USB-stuurprogramma's voor Windows en Mac
- Handmatig Android USB-stuurprogramma's op uw pc installeren
Rahul is een student Computerwetenschappen met een enorme interesse op het gebied van technische en cryptocurrency-onderwerpen. Hij brengt het grootste deel van zijn tijd door met schrijven of luisteren naar muziek of reizen naar onbekende plaatsen. Hij gelooft dat chocolade de oplossing is voor al zijn problemen. Het leven gebeurt, en koffie helpt.